VI. B. Read the text Greenwich and then discuss it
In the 18tft century Greenwich was only a riverside village near London. Today it is part of London and you can get there by the river Thames, on special regular cruises from Westminster, Charing Cross, and Tower Piers. Greenwich has the oldest London park - Royal Park, as well as being home to magnificent buildings designed by Sir Christopher Wren.
One of the most important places in Greenwich is the National Maritime Museum. Its exhibitions explain how and why Britain became a leading sea power, and present the two main figures in its history: Lord Nelson and Captain James Cook. Video presentations of modern ships and huge paintings presenting historic battles all help you trace the development of Britain's sea history.
VI. C. Read the text Alaska and then discuss it (from Easy English № 14)
Alaska is the 49th state of America and one of the most interesting places in the world. Not everybody is able to visit it, so join us in our journey to this great land.
Alaska is a huge area placed partially within the Subarctic Zone, in the north western corner of Noth America. Its coastline is rugged by plenty of fjords, cliffs, peninsulas and islands. It is home to the highest mountain of North America, McKinley, which is 6193m high. The capital of Alaska is Juneau and its biggest cities are Anchorage, Sitka and Kodiak.
Sightseeing and photography of wildlife are favourite visitor’s attractions. Fishing and dogsleds are also available for tourists. You cannot miss the National Parks of Alaska rich in moose, reindeer, grizzly bears, sea lions, seals and swans. The flower symbol of Alaska, the forget-me-not, speaks for itself – you will never forget this charming land.
